What types of insurance would you need to include in a risk management plan for your family?
Alchen [17]

1. Health

Ensures that health costs are mitigated

2. Homeowners or Rental Insurance

Covers you in the case of disaster, theft, etc. If you volunteer on a board, can also be used to cover you if you are sued.

3. Life insurance

Ensures money for family upon death

4. Car/Motorcycle/Boat Insurance

Ensures protection in case of vehicle related accident

5. Liability insurance

Depending on the type of work done

6. Pet insurance

Depending on type of pet owned and plan for long term health

7. Flood insurance

Different from homeowners and crucial in this era of climate change.
